Two players, one browser tab each
One of you opens the game and is given a six-character code. The other types it in — or opens the invite link — and lands in the same battle, wherever they are. Neither of you downloads this mod, and neither of you installs anything.
One of you runs the actual game, so that person supplies the Heroes II data — once, from their own machine.

Worth knowing before you start
You both see the same picture — including each other's spellbook and army. It is built for playing with someone you know, not for blind competitive play.
A single battle, with a rematch after each one. The adventure map and the campaigns stay single-player — those are the browser version and the download.
The two browsers are introduced by a small endpoint on this site and then talk directly. Finding that direct path uses STUN alone, so strict company networks and some mobile ones will not get through at all.
The host's game data is read in their own browser and never leaves the machine. What travels is the picture, the sound and the clicks.
